In recent years, geometric calculations have gained popularity in various fields, including architecture, engineering, and computer science. One fundamental concept that has sparked interest among enthusiasts is determining the altitude of a triangle. Understanding how to calculate altitude can be a crucial aspect of solving complex geometric problems and visualizing 3D structures.
